Output cac8a8f366e074da7172e41a60e981c384098677399b28dea9539bf1bcc3b46a:5

value
23623452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ecfddb1b50377e97b7311dcdf1c58628205c261 OP_EQUAL
address
3Ei8tZnTq1xYRZ1PWewVPWjeiqGSdTfn92
transaction
cac8a8f366e074da7172e41a60e981c384098677399b28dea9539bf1bcc3b46a
spent
true